Better Community Living Inc. is a leading provider of human services, day habilitation, and residential care for adults and children with autism and developmental disabilities in the Greater New Bedford area. With more than 25 years of experience, the organization empowers residents to become productive community members through family‑centered support, employment opportunities, and high‑quality shared living arrangements. Its comprehensive programs—including full‑time day habilitation, recreation for children, and free residential services—are designed to foster meaningful friendships and a sense of belonging. Better Community Living’s collaborative culture values each individual’s voice and prioritizes compassionate, client‑focused care, making it a distinctive choice for professionals seeking a mission‑driven workplace.
The Medical Coordinator will train and support Residential Group Home Managers on healthcare related processes, monitor medical appointments, and assist with medication audits. They will also attend staff meetings and support Manager/staff with MAP and medically related issues.
